探索高效前端开发:多模块管理策略与实践

15次阅读

共计 945 个字符,预计需要花费 3 分钟才能阅读完成。

探索高效前端开发:多模块管理策略与实践

在当今快节奏的软件开发环境中,前端开发扮演着至关重要的角色。随着项目的复杂性不断增加,高效的前端开发策略变得尤为重要。本文将深入探讨多模块管理策略,这是一种提高前端开发效率和质量的有效方法。

什么是多模块管理?

多模块管理是一种前端开发策略,它涉及将大型项目分解为多个独立模块。每个模块负责应用程序的一部分功能,可以独立开发、测试和部署。这种方法有助于提高代码的可维护性、可重用性和可测试性。

多模块管理的好处

  1. 提高可维护性 :通过将代码分解为更小的、独立的模块,可以更容易地理解和修改代码。
  2. 促进代码重用 :独立的模块可以在不同的项目或应用程序中重用,节省开发时间。
  3. 简化测试 :模块化允许更精确地测试每个功能,确保代码质量。
  4. 增强团队协作 :不同的团队成员可以同时处理不同的模块,提高开发效率。
  5. 支持持续集成和部署 :模块化使得持续集成和部署更加容易实现。

实施多模块管理策略的步骤

  1. 项目规划 :确定项目的需求和目标,将项目分解为多个模块。
  2. 模块设计 :为每个模块定义清晰的职责和接口。
  3. 技术选型 :选择适合模块化开发的技术栈,例如使用 Vue.js、React 或 Angular 等框架。
  4. 编码实践 :遵循良好的编码规范,确保代码的可读性和可维护性。
  5. 测试策略 :为每个模块编写单元测试和集成测试,确保模块的功能和质量。
  6. 持续集成 :设置自动化的构建和测试流程,确保代码的一致性和稳定性。
  7. 部署与监控 :将模块部署到生产环境,并进行性能监控和优化。

实践案例

以一个电子商务网站为例,我们可以将网站分为以下几个模块:

  1. 用户认证模块 :处理用户登录、注册和权限验证。
  2. 产品展示模块 :展示产品列表和详细信息。
  3. 购物车模块 :管理用户的购物车和订单。
  4. 支付模块 :处理支付流程和第三方支付接口集成。
  5. 评论和评分模块 :允许用户对产品进行评论和评分。

每个模块都可以独立开发、测试和部署,提高了开发效率和质量。

结论

多模块管理策略是提高前端开发效率和质量的有效方法。通过将大型项目分解为多个独立模块,可以更容易地管理和维护代码,促进代码重用,简化测试,增强团队协作,并支持持续集成和部署。实施多模块管理策略需要良好的项目规划、模块设计、技术选型、编码实践、测试策略和持续集成。通过实践案例,我们可以看到多模块管理策略在实际项目中的应用和优势。

正文完
 0